The Art Of Human Performance, Ep 1 With Jonny Huntington
Episode one of a mini series on Human Performance featuring Jonny Huntington. Jonny is a world class Elite Para skier, climber and explorer, former army officer and ultra runner. Only recently Jonny has finished a 350km 11 day ultra marathon from Manchester to London 2014 was a pivotal point in Jonny’s life after suffering a bleed on the brain, causing paralysis from the neck down to his left side. After vigorous and extensive rehabilitation Jonny was discharged from the Army and trained his way to representing GB in disabled cross country skiing. However the biggest challenge is yet to come. Jonny is setting his sights on becoming the first becoming the first ever disabled person to travel from the edge of Antarctica to the South Pole solo, unsupported and unassisted! Jonny is a sports scientist with a keen interest in psychology, nutrition and physiology. As well as being a performance coach to athletes and leaders alike. ”First and foremost, I’m an athlete. My injury hasn’t changed this. It may cause me to rethink my approach towards training or a certain event, but intrinsically the challenge is the same – with the right attitude and hard work, anything is achievable”

Episode 39 - Andrea Fawell, Making The Extraordinary Ordinary
Episode 39 with Andrea Fawell. This episode brings to the pod a very accomplished athlete. Andrea and I have been working together for a while now and as a team, have already hit some notable success, including the Summer Spine race, a 268 mile continuous ultra marathon. But there is so much more to Andrea! Having completed various Ironman triathlons, Ultra runs including the infamous Marathon Des Sables and the Devizes to Westminster Kayak challenge, Andrea is now on a mission to help understand the effects of climate change on the Polar Ice caps and beyond. We talk adventure, challenges, perception of self and much much more. As ever, take a listen, learn and grow.
